在合约设计中,安全性是一个关键因素。为了保护合约不受攻击和漏洞的影响,一些设计模式可显著提高合约的安全性。了解这些模式能够帮助开发者在设计智能合约时做出更明智的决策。
使用多签名合约是一种有效的安全措施。在多签名合约中,执行某项操作需要多个授权
在发布智能合约之前,开发者需要进行系统的自我审计,以确保合约的安全性和功能的有效性。审计不仅仅是代码的检查,更是对整体设计思路和业务逻辑的深刻理解。通过一系列的自我审计步骤,开发者可以识别并修复潜在的漏洞,提高合约的可靠性。
在开始审计之前,开
在选择一个合适的智能合约审计工具或平台时,有几个关键因素需要认真考虑。了解自己的需求至关重要。不同的项目有不同的复杂性和特性,因此审计工具应该能够满足项目的特定要求。例如,对于一些简单的合约,基本的审计工具可能就足够了,而对于复杂的合约,可能需要更专
发布时间:2026/5/30 7:38
智能合约的安全性评估是一个复杂而多维的过程,其核心是通过多种方法与工具来识别和修复潜在的安全漏洞。评估的目标在于确保智能合约在执行期间不会遭受攻击,且所有的逻辑和业务需求均得到满足。以下几个方面是审计过程中可以侧重的部分。目标明确是评估过程中的重要
发布时间:2026/5/30 7:08
在智能合约审计中,权限管理是一个至关重要的方面。权限管理的核心在于确保合约中的不同角色及其权限能够得到合理的控制和管理,避免出现恶意行为或意外错误对系统造成影响。因为一旦权限分配不当,可能导致资产损失或者系统崩溃。因此,审计者需要对权限管理进行详细的
发布时间:2026/5/30 6:38
在审计智能合约时,最普遍的漏洞种类与风险点往往表现在多个方面。对这些潜在安全隐患的理解,对于开发者和审计师来说,都是至关重要的。一个常见的漏洞类型是重入攻击,这种攻击方式允许攻击者在合约的过程中插入额外的调用,从而引发不必要的状态更改。攻击者可以在某
发布时间:2026/5/30 6:08